Buying Guide

Choose the right material

Neoprene offers oil and weather resistance for many gasket uses; verify chemical compatibility with your media before selecting

Match thickness to flange gap

Common gasket thicknesses shown here include 1/32 in to 1/8 in—thicker sheets compress more and suit larger gaps, while thinner sheets work for tight tolerances

Consider roll width and length

Rolls and long sheets allow custom cutting for irregular gaskets; pick a width that minimizes waste for your typical part sizes

Look for consistent durometer and density

Uniform hardness and material density ensure predictable compression and sealing performance under bolt load

Think about cutting and handling

Thin sheets are easier to hand-cut; thicker rolls may require shears or a die for precise gasket edges

Assess vibration and damping needs

Neoprene provides basic vibration damping—choose thicker or denser sheets when isolation or cushioning is required
